SPARK LIMESTONE RIDGE SPARKLING RIESLING 2014 Traditional method, VQA Twenty Mile Bench, Niagara Peninsula
Vintage Assessments Tasting Note Producer TAWSE
Extremely pale straw colour. Attractive, slightly spicy, faintly honeyed, gently toasty, mineral-driven, ripe apple-melon-lemon, brioche-tinged nose. Dry, medium to medium-light bodied, slightly spicy, bright, lively, ripe lemon-melon-apple flavours with an unoaked, effervescent, lingering, very crisp, mineral-tinged finish. This repeat seems slightly better than the recommended 2014 (**/**+) released on June 11, 2016 at $19.95. TONY ASPLER / 88.5-points / BUY- Mineraly, apple and lemon peel nose; medium to light-bodied, crisply dry, apple flavour with a honeyed note and a light floral note. Has 11.5% alcohol and 12 g/L residual sugar.
